Skateboard facilities by summer?

SKATEBOARD facilities could be installed at the Park View play area in Berkeley by the end of the summer.

Berkeley Town Council must spend a £3,600 grant that it wasawarded for provision of such facilities by the end of August or the money will be lost.

It is considering installing a half-pipe on the area where some play equipment was burnt down on the Park View site.

Speaking of how local could perceive the idea, Cllr John Freeland said: "We have to have somewhere to keep the skateboarders off the roads. A little bit of noise during daylight hours and in the evenings is only to be expected from a play area."
